Software Developer (UI/Front-end)
Beauceron Security Inc. is a fast-growing cybersecurity start-up based out of Fredericton, New Brunswick. Our aim is to turn our clients' current greatest source of vulnerabilities – people, process and culture – into their greatest security asset, allowing them to become more resilient in the face of growing online threats. To do that, we've developed an innovative approach to measuring, managing and monitoring cyber risk.
With a small, passionate team and a fast-paced environment, you will be able to see the impact of your work everyday.
Reporting to the Chief Technology Officer, the Software Developer is responsible for the development and implementation of UI and front-end functionality in the Beauceron Security Inc. cloud-based Software as a Service. This individual must be able to work closely with other team members in an agile development environment to build product features, based on requirements set out by product architects.
Role and RESPONSIBILITIES
You’ll be a key member of our team, and will help Beauceron Security Inc. develop innovative new features and functionality as well as providing support to our growing customer base.
Build functional User Interface elements using industry best practices.
Work closely with designers and other Software Developers to build product features.
Find innovative ways to improve interface architecture.
Use testing best practices to ensure development quality.
Knowledge and Experience
University degree, Community College or Private College Diploma.
Relevant industry experience would be considered an asset.
Thorough understanding of the current state of web technology and best practices.
Knowledge of web accessibility standards such as ARIA for use with screen readers.
Proficiency for Design would be considered an asset.
Strong knowledge of frameworks/libraries such as jQuery and Bootstrap.
Experience with AJAX and REST APIs.
Knowledge of PHP or other server-side programming languages would be an asset.
Experience with source code control systems such as Git.
Familiarity with Agile development methodologies.
Understanding of Quality Assurance best practices and technologies.
Experience with Docker or Kubernetes would be considered an asset
Compensation and Benefits
Training and Development Opportunities
Office located in the heart of downtown Fredericton and close to great restaurants, cafes and a beautiful riverside trail.
Be part of an experienced, energetic team working on a rapid, agile development schedule. Help shape the future of the product – you’ll be more than just another cog in the machine.
If you’re looking to work with a talented group of professionals, in a rewarding work environment, at a fast-growing company with the opportunity to have a real impact, we want to hear from you!
Please email us at email@example.com with:
· a PDF of your resume or link to a complete LinkedIn Profile.
· a link to your portfolio/GitHub/etc where we can see some of the work you’ve done.